Maurice Tempelsman, Jacqueline Kennedy Onassis’ longtime partner up until her death, has died at 95 after complications from a fall, according to his son, Leon. Tempelsman was a Belgian-American jewel tycoon who made a fortune selling diamonds from Africa’s Gold Coast.
